Yes. If you don't select an item, or you select one that has no properties, that button is disabled. You need to click on an item in that list that has properties that you can modify, like TCP/IPv4.

What does your red box around IPv4 mean? It doesn't look to me like you've actually selected that line - usually it would be highlighted in some way such as reverse video.

(The fact that a 'description' for IPv4 shows up does not mean the IPv4 item is actually selected... which is a little weird way to arrange a UI, but that's how it is).

If you had selected IPv4, it ought to have properties.

If you did select an item, and the button is still disabled then its a rights issue. Either you are running under a standard user account, or if you are running with admin rights, some kind of policy has been put in place so you cannot change those settings.
